  • The Hippo pathway is dysregulated in cancer-associated fibroblasts (CAFs) in anti-PD-L1 resistant cancers.
  • Study analyzed RNA-sequencing data from 2800 bladder cancer patients and single-cell data from 200 samples.
  • Hippo dysregulation in stromal cells, not cancer cells, drives high YAP/TAZ signals in resistant tumors.
  • Hippo signaling is specifically altered in CAFs compared to healthy donor fibroblasts.
  • Inhibition of YAP signaling with a pan-TEAD inhibitor reduced myofibroblast gene expression and CAF contractility.
  • Findings could help develop therapeutic combinations to improve immune checkpoint inhibitor outcomes.
